Experts are now debating whether cholesterol needs to go even lower than previously thought for some patients.
Current guidelines recommend an LDL < 100 mg/dL for patients with heart disease or diabetes.
This target will probably be lowered to 70 mg/dL... especially for patients with unstable heart disease. In fact, some experts now say "go as low as you can go" in these patients.
